LOCATION OF (1) POSITION(S) TO BE FILLED: DEPARTMENT OF MENTAL HEALTH & SUBSTANCE ABUSE SERVICES, MEMPHIS MENTAL HEALTH INSTITUTE, SHELBY COUNTY Qualifications Education and Experience: Graduation from an accredited college or university with a master's degree in a nursing clinical specialty area with preparation in specialized practitioner skills or possession of a Certificate of Fitness from the Tennessee Board of Nursing. Necessary Special Qualifications: Licensed or eligible for licensure as a Registered Nurse with Advanced Practice Nurse certificate in the State of Tennessee and current national certification or eligible for national certification in the appropriate nursing specialty area. Licensure as a Registered Nurse with Advanced Practice Nurse certificate in the State of Tennessee and national certification in the appropriate nursing specialty area are required within 60 days after employment. Possession of a Certificate of Fitness from the Tennessee Board of Nursing is also required within 60 days after employment. Overview The Family Medicine Nurse Practitioner (FNP) in the psychiatric hospital provides comprehensive medical care to patients admitted for acute and chronic mental health conditions. The FNP collaborates with family/internal medicine physicians, psychiatrists, nursing staff, therapists, and interdisciplinary team members to manage co-occurring medical conditions, conduct medical evaluations, and ensure continuity of care. The role focuses on integrating physical health with behavioral health services to improve overall patient outcomes. Responsibilities The functional job responsibilities include but are not limited to; perform comprehensive medical histories and physical examinations for psychiatric inpatients, evaluate and manage acute and chronic medical conditions in patients with mental health disorders, order, interpret, and document diagnostic tests (labs, imaging, EKGs), initiate, adjust, and monitor medications for medical conditions, monitor for and manage side effects of psychiatric medications (e.g., metabolic syndrome, EPS, cardiac effects), collaborate with physicians regarding medical treatment plans, provide health education to patients and families regarding medical conditions and wellness, respond to medical emergencies and participate in rapid response/code situations, ensure compliance with hospital policies, regulatory standards, and quality initiatives, participate in interdisciplinary treatment team meetings, coordinate discharge planning related to medical needs and continuity of care, and maintain accurate, timely documentation in the electronic health record.
